Description

This specimen features several tabular arsenohauchicornite crystals to 4.00 mm with crystals of millerite to 3.00 mm and bismuthinite crystals to 1.00 mm in vugs between the arsenohauchicornite crystals. Most of the arsenohauchicornite crystals are broken but there are two fairly sharp complete crystals 1.00 mm in size shown in the photos.

Approximately 25% of the matrix is silvery-black crystalline arsenohauchicornite. Also present is minor sphalerite, micro siderite crystals and massive quartz. 

One side of the specimen has been sawn.

The identiy of the arsenohauchicornite, bismuthinite, and the siderite has been confirmed by EDS. See the analysis tab for the reports.
